Emergency Department Information System Market is expected to reach US$ 2.28 Bn. at a CAGR of 15.1 % during the forecast period 2029. Major factors driving the emergency department information system market include a rise in patient flow at emergency departments, rising geriatric population, growing rate of accidents, and population growth. Emergency department information system captures real-time information about patients and to support the operational control of emergency departments. Emergency Department Information System is useful in managing data and workflow to support emergency department patient care and operations. Software type segment is bifurcated as enterprise solutions and best-of-breed solutions. Best-of-breed sub solutions segment expected to dominate the software type segment during the forecast period. Best-of-breed solutions provide improvements in physician productivity, diagnostic enhancements, and enhanced interoperability and these factors are driving the best-of-breed solutions segment growth. Delivery mode segment is classified as on-premise EDIS and software-as-a-service (SaaS). Various applications covered under the scope of this reports are computerized physician order entry (CPOE), patient tracking & triage, clinical documentation, E-prescribing, resource tracking, and management and other applications. An end-user segment is divided into small hospitals, medium-sized hospitals, and large hospitals. The market on the basis of geography is segmented by North America, Europe, Asia-Pacific, Middle East & Africa, and Latin America. APAC is going to emerge as the highest growth region in emergency department information system market in the forecast period followed by North America and Europe. Rising healthcare infrastructure and facilities in Latin America have given rise to the market in Latin America. The Middle East and Africa are slow growing markets due to slow growth of the economy in the countries.
